Beyond “Knowing Better”: How to Actually Change

On “Behind the Quote,” hosts Jessica Reyes, Patricia Wu, and guest therapist and transformative coach Allison Guilbault discuss Maya Angelou’s quote: “Do the best you can until you know better. Then when you know better, do better.”

Past Decisions, Present Knowledge

We make choices based on what we know at the time. Reframe past mistakes as learning opportunities for the future.

Change Takes Time

Don’t be discouraged when change is slow. Self-compassion is key, even for our struggles.

The Power of Small Steps

Focus on small adjustments, not complete overhauls. Consistent, small shifts bring transformative change.
